NOIP初赛复习 (2)(5)

2018-12-20 22:54

下列关于程序语言的叙述,不正确的是( )。

A)编写机器代码不比编写汇编代码容易。

B)高级语言需要编译成目标代码或通过解释器解释后才能被CPU执行。 C)同样一段高级语言程序通过不同的编译器可能产生不同的可执行程序。 D)汇编代码可被CPU直接运行。 E)不同的高级语言语法略有不同。

如果52-19=33是成立的,则52、19、33分别是 。

(A)八进制、十进制、十六进制 (B)十进制、十六进制、八进制 (C)八进制、十六进制、十进制 (D)十进制、八进制、十六进制 把下列二进制数分别化成八进制数、十六进制数和十进制数。

(1)1110B (2)-101010B (3)10.0101B (4) 101101.11B

某个车站呈狭长形,宽度只能容下一台车,并且只有一个出入口。已知某时刻该车站状态为空,从这一时刻开始的出入记录为:“进,出,进,进,出,进,进,进,出,出,进,出”。假设车辆入站的顺序为1,2,3,??,则车辆出站的顺序为( )。

A. 1, 2, 3, 4, 5 B. 1, 2, 4, 5, 7 C. 1, 3, 5, 4, 6 D. 1, 3, 5, 6, 7 E. 1, 3, 6, 5, 7

某大学计算机专业的必修课及其先修课程如下表所示: 课程代号 课程名称 先修课程 C0 高等数学 C1 程序设计语言 C2 离散数学 C3 数据结构 C4 编译技术 C5 操作系统 C3, C7 C6 普通物理 C0 C7 计算机原理 C6 C0, C1 C1, C2 C3 请你判断下列课程安排方案哪个是不合理的( )。 A. C0, C6, C7, C1, C2, C3, C4, C5 B. C0, C1, C2, C3, C4, C6, C7, C5 C. C0, C1, C6, C7, C2, C3, C4, C5 D. C0, C1, C6, C7, C5, C2, C3, C4

E. C0, C1, C2, C3, C6, C7, C5, C4

设栈S的初始状态为空,元素a, b, c, d, e, f, g依次入栈,以下出栈序列不可能出现的是 ( )。 A. a, b, c, e, d, f, g D. d, c, f, e, b, a, g

B. b, c, a, f, e, g, d E. g, e, f, d, c, b, a

C. a, e, d, c, b, f, g

在所有排序方法中,关键字比较的次数与记录的初始排列次序无关的是( ) 。 A) 希尔排序 B) 起泡排序 C) 插入排序 D) 选择排序

七、排列组合

例题

由3个a,1个b和2个c构成的所有字符串中,包含子串“abc”的共有( )个。

A. 20 B. 8 C. 16 D. 12 E. 24

由3个a,5个b和2个c构成的所有字符串中,包含子串“abc”的共有( )个。

A. 40320 B. 39600 C. 840 D. 780 E. 60 8*7!/2!/4!-4*C(5,2)-4*5=8*3*5*7-40-20=840-60=780

八、综合

下面一段程序是用( )语言书写的。 int func1(int n){ int i,sum=0; for(i=1;i<=n;i++) sum+=i*i; return sum; }

A) FORTRAN B) PASCAL C) C D) PROLOG E) BASIC

多媒体计算机是指( ) 计算机。

A)专供家庭使用的 B)装有CD-ROM的

B)连接在网络上的高级 D) 具有处理文字、图形、声音、影像等信息的

在WORD文档编辑中实现图文混合排版时,关于文本框的下列叙述正确的是( ) 。 A)文本框中的图形没有办法和文档中输入文字叠加在一起,只能在文档的不同位置 B)文本框中的图形不可以衬于文档中输入的文字的下方。

C) 通过文本框,可以实现图形和文档中输入的文字的叠加,也可实现文字环绕。 D) 将图形放入文本框后,文档中输入的文字不能环绕图形。

计算机软件保护法是用来保护软件( )的。 A)编写权 B)复制权 C)使用权 D)著作权

64KB的存储器用十六进制表示,它的最大的地址码是( ) A)10000 B)FFFF C)1FFFF D)EFFFF

在外部设备中,绘图仪属于( )

A. 输入设备 B.输出设备 C. 辅(外)存储器 D.主(内)存储器

电线上停着两种鸟(A,B),可以看出两只相邻的鸟就将电线分为了一个线段。这些线段可分为两类;

一类是两端的小鸟相同;另一类则是两端的小鸟不相同。

已知:电线两个顶点上正好停着相同的小鸟,试问两端为不同小鸟的线段数目一定是( )。 A.奇数 B. 偶数 C. 可奇可偶 D. 数目固定

计算机能直接执行的指令包括两部分,它们是( ). A.源操作数与目标操作数 B.操作码与操作数

C.ASCII码与汉字代码 D.数字与字符

解释程序的功能是( )

A)将高级语言程序转换为目标程序 B)将汇编语言程序转换为目标程序

C)解释执行高级语言程序 D)解释执行汇编语言程序

十进制数13和14,进行“与”操作的结果是( ) A.27 B.12 1101 and 1110=1100=12

以下排序方法,那种是稳定的( ) A.希尔排序 B.堆排序

C.冒泡排序 D.快速排序

排序的稳定性指的是对于原来所有的a[i]=a[j],i

计算机能够自动工作,主要是因为采用了( ) A. 二进制数制 B. 高速电子元件 C. 存储程序控制 D. 程序设计语言

当计算机的主存储器的容量达到1GB的时候,其地址的表示至少需要( )位 A.10 B.20 C.30 D.40

30

1024*1024*1024Byte=2Byte,每个字节的地址用一个数表示,所以需要30个位。

TCP/IP协议中,不属于应用层的是( ) A.WWW B.FTP C.SMTP D.TCP

借助一个栈,输入顺序是123456,以下输出顺序不可能的是( ) A.142356 B.123654 C.231456 D.213546

对整数N=8934632178,每次删除一个位置上的数字,使得新的数尽可能小,那么第四次删掉的数字是( ) A.6 B.8 C.7

D.4 C.15

D.11

中缀表达式A-(B+C/D)*E的后缀表达式形式是( ) A. AB-C+D/E* B. ABC+D/-E* C. ABCD/E*+- D. ABCD/+E*-

对n个元素从小到大排序,已将它们分成了n/k组,每组k个数。而且每组中的所有数都大于前一组的所有数。那么采用基于比较的排序,时间下界是( ) A.O(nlogn) B. O(nlogk) C. O(klogn) D. O(klogk)

计算机是由( )、控制器、存储器、输入设备和输出设备构成的 A.ROM B.I/O C.CPU D.ALU ALU算术逻辑单元,即通常所说的运算器。

ASCII码的主要作用是( )

A.方便信息交换 B.方便信息存储 C.便于管理 D.便于输出

现在的计算机通常是将处理程序放在连续的内存地址中。CPU在执行这个处理程序时,是使用一个叫做( )的寄存器来指示程序的执行顺序。 A.累加寄存器 器

结构化程序设计的一种基本方法是( ) A.归纳法

B.逐步求精法

C.递归法

D.筛选法

B.指令寄存器

C.内存地址寄存器

D.指令地址寄存

在微型计算机中,常用( )码实现十进制数与二进制数之间的自动转换。 (A) BCD码 (B) ASCII码 (C) 海明码 (D) 机内码

已知A=11001010B,B=00001111B,C=01011100B,A V B∧C=( )B。 (A) 11001110 (B) 01110110 (C) 11101110 (D) 01001100

逻辑代数式子f=AB+ABC+AB(C+D), 则f的简化式子为( )。 (A)AB (B) A+B (C) ABC (D) ABCD

插入排序是一种简单实用的工具,在对数组排序时,我们可能用二分查找,对要插入的元素快速找到在已经排好元素序列中的位置。下面的描述中正确的是( )。(A) 二分查找的时间复杂度为O(lgN),因此排序的时间复杂度为O(N*lgN)

(B) 二分查找的时间复杂度为O(N),因此排序的时间复杂度为O(N*lgN) (C) 二分查找的时间复杂度为O(lgN),因此排序的时间复杂度为O(N*N) (D) 二分查找的时间复杂度为O(N),因此排序的时间复杂度为O(N*N)

十进制数11/128可用二进制数码序列表示为( ) 。

A)1011/1000000 B)1011/100000000 C) 0.001011 D) 0.0001011

[x]补码=10011000,其原码为(B )

A)011001111 B)11101000 C)11100110 D)01100101

下面哪些计算机网络不是按覆盖地域划分的( ) A.局域网 B. 都市网 C.广域网 D. 星型网

设栈S和队列Q的初始状态为空,元素e1,e2,e3,e4,e5,e6依次通过栈S,一个元素出栈后即进入队列Q,若出队的顺序为e2,e4,e3,e6,e5,e1,则栈S的容量至少应该为( ) 。

A) 2 B) 3 C) 4 D) 5

以下哪一个不是栈的基本运算( )

A)删除栈顶元素 B)删除栈底的元素 C)判断栈是否为空 D)将栈置为空栈

在顺序表(2,5,7,10,14,15,18,23,35,41,52)中,用二分查找12,所需的关键码比较的次数为( )

A)2 B)3 C)4 D)5

某数列有1000个各不相同的单元,由低至高按序排列;现要对该数列进行二分查找(binary-search),在最坏的情况下,需检视( )个单元。

A.1000 B. 10 C. 100 D. 500

线性表若采用链表存贮结构,要求内存中可用存贮单元地址( )

A.必须连续 B. 部分地址必须连续 C. 一定不连续 D. 连续不连续均可

下列叙述中,正确的是( )

A.线性表的线性存贮结构优于链表存贮结构 B.队列的操作方式是先进后出

C.栈的操作方式是先进先出 D. 二维数组是指它的每个数据元素为一个线性表的线性表

设有一个共有n级的楼梯,某人每步可走1级,也可走2级,也可走3级,用递推公式给出某人从底层开始走完全部楼梯的走法。例如:当n=3时,共有4种走法,即1+1+1,1+2,2+1,3。

F(n)=f(n-1)+f(n-2)+f(n-3),n>=4; F(1)=1; f(2)=2; f(3)=4;

电线上停着两种鸟(A,B),可以看出两只相邻的鸟就将电线分为了一个线段。这些线段可分为两类;

一类是两端的小鸟相同;另一类则是两端的小鸟不相同。 已知:电线两个顶点上正好停着相同的小鸟,试问两端为不同小鸟的线段数目一定是( )。 A.奇数 B. 偶数 C. 可奇可偶 D. 数目固定

192.168.0.1属于( )

A. A类地址 B.B类地址 C. C类地址 D. D类地址 关于“0”的原码、反码和补码描述正确的是( ) A.“0”的原码只有一种表示方法 B.“0”的反码只有一种表示方法 C.“0”的补码只有一种表示方法

D.“0”的原码、反码和补码均有两种表示方法

借助一个栈,输入顺序是123456,以下输出顺序不可能的是( ) A.142356

B.123654

C.231456

D.213546

128KB的存储器用十六进制表示,它的最大的地址码是( ) A)10000 B)EFFF C)1FFFF D)FFFFF E)FFFF

能将高级语言程序转换为目标程序的是( )

A)调试程序 B)解释程序 C)编辑程序 D)编译程序 E)连接程序

下列属于冯.诺依曼计算机模型的核心思想是( )。 A)采用二进制表示数据和指令; B)采用”存储程序”工作方式

C)计算机硬件有五大部件(运算器、控制器、存储器、输入和输出设备) D)结构化程序设计方法 E)计算机软件只有系统软件

下面关于算法的正确的说法是( ) A)算法必须有输出

B)算法必须在计算机上用某种语言实现 C)算法不一定有输入

D)算法必须在有限步执行后能结束 E)算法的每一步骤必须有确切的定义

下列关于十进制数100的正确说法是( )。 A)原码为01100100B B)反码为64H C)反码为9BH D)补码为64H E)补码为9BH

图灵 (Alan Turing) 是 ( )。

A) 美国人 B) 英国人 C) 德国人 D) 匈牙利人 E) 法国人

第一个给计算机写程序的人是( )。

A) Alan Mathison Turing B) Ada Lovelace C) John von Neumann D) John Mc-Carthy E) Edsger Wybe Dijkstra

下列关于高级语言的说法错误的是( )。

A. Fortran是历史上的第一个面向科学计算的高级语言 B. Pascal和C都是编译执行的高级语言 C. C++是历史上的第一个支持面向对象的语言 D. 编译器将高级语言程序转变为目标代码

E. 高级语言程序比汇编语言程序更容易从一种计算机移植到另一种计算机上


NOIP初赛复习 (2)(5).doc 将本文的Word文档下载到电脑 下载失败或者文档不完整,请联系客服人员解决!

下一篇:四螨嗪-联苯肼酯液相色谱

相关阅读
本类排行
× 注册会员免费下载(下载后可以自由复制和排版)

马上注册会员

注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信: QQ: